About On The Rise Artisan Breads

On The Rise Artisan Breads is a beloved bakery and cake shop in Cleveland Heights, offering a warm, welcoming destination for anyone seeking exceptional baked goods, fresh coffee, and thoughtfully prepared café fare.

Located at 3471 Fairmount Blvd, this gourmet bakery and café is known for its European-style loaves, handcrafted pastries, and seasonal lunch offerings inspired by local ingredients and a locavore approach.
